Overview of Rockingham Community College

Rockingham Community College is located in Wentworth, North Carolina (a rural area). The school is a public institution. The highest degree level offered by Rockingham Community College is the Associate's degree.

Areas of Study

The range of program offerings available from the school is especially impressive compared to its number of students. Rockingham Community College is known for its programs in security and law enforcement.

Rockingham Community College Selectivity

The school is an open-admission school.

Faculty

Rockingham Community College maintains a faculty/student ratio (full-time) which is better than most colleges.

Student Body

The school had 2,055 enrolled students in 2005. A large number of students at Rockingham Community College are 40 years old or older.
